Why Outdoor Air Conditioner Covers Are Necessary

I’ve found that using an outdoor air conditioner cover is a simple way to help protect my unit from weather damage. When my AC is exposed to rain, snow, dust, and falling leaves, it can wear down faster over time. A cover helps reduce that exposure, which gives me more peace of mind and can help my system last longer.

I also like that a cover can keep debris from getting inside the unit during the off-season. Things like dirt, twigs, and leaves can build up around the outdoor system and make it harder to maintain. By covering it, I feel like I’m taking one easy step to keep the unit cleaner and reduce unnecessary problems later.

For me, the biggest benefit is prevention. Replacing or repairing an air conditioner can be expensive, so anything that helps protect it feels worthwhile. An outdoor AC cover is a small investment that can help me avoid bigger maintenance issues and keep my system in better condition year after year.

My Buying Guides on Outdoor Air Conditioner Covers

Why I Use an Outdoor Air Conditioner Cover

When I first started looking into outdoor air conditioner covers, I wanted something that would help protect my unit from debris, dirt, leaves, and harsh weather. Over time, I realized that a good cover can help keep the exterior cleaner and reduce wear from exposure. I also learned that the right cover should protect without trapping too much moisture or restricting airflow when the unit is not in use.

What I Look for in Material Quality

One of the first things I check is the material. I prefer covers made from durable, weather-resistant fabrics like heavy-duty vinyl, polyester, or waterproof canvas. In my experience, thinner materials tend to tear or fade quickly, especially under strong sun, rain, or snow. I also pay attention to whether the material is UV-resistant, because that helps the cover last longer outdoors.

Why Proper Fit Matters to Me

Fit is extremely important when I buy an outdoor air conditioner cover. If the cover is too loose, it can blow off in the wind or collect water. If it is too tight, it may be difficult to place over the unit and may not provide full protection. I always measure my air conditioner carefully and compare those measurements with the product size chart before buying.

Features I Prefer in a Good Cover

From my experience, the best covers include practical features that make them easier to use. I like adjustable straps, elastic hems, or drawstrings because they help keep the cover secure. Ventilation panels are also useful since they can reduce condensation buildup. Handles or side openings can make installation much easier, especially when I need to remove or replace the cover often.

How I Think About Weather Protection

Since outdoor units are exposed to changing weather, I always consider how much protection a cover offers. I look for water resistance or waterproofing for rainy seasons, and I want enough strength to handle snow, dust, and falling leaves. In windy areas, I choose a cover with secure fastening so it stays in place. For sunny climates, UV protection is a major plus in my opinion.

Why I Consider Breathability

Breathability is something I learned to value after using a cover that trapped too much moisture. I now look for covers that help reduce condensation and allow some air circulation. This matters because excess moisture can lead to mold, mildew, or corrosion over time. For me, a cover should protect the unit while still helping it stay dry and in good condition.

How I Check Ease of Use

I always think about how easy the cover will be to put on and take off. A cover that is too complicated becomes annoying to use regularly. I prefer lightweight but sturdy designs that I can manage on my own. If I need to cover and uncover the unit seasonally, I want the process to be quick and simple.

What I Look for in Maintenance

I like covers that are easy to clean because outdoor use can make them dusty or dirty fast. In my experience, materials that can be wiped down or rinsed off are the most convenient. I also check whether the cover resists mold and mildew, since that helps reduce maintenance and extends the life of the product.

How I Balance Price and Value

When I shop, I do not always choose the cheapest option. I look for the best value based on durability, fit, and protection. A slightly higher-priced cover often lasts much longer and performs better, which saves me money in the long run. For me, value means getting reliable protection without having to replace the cover every season.

My Final Buying Advice

If I were buying an outdoor air conditioner cover today, I would focus on fit, durable material, weather protection, breathability, and ease of use. I have found that the best cover is one that protects the unit without creating new problems like trapped moisture or poor airflow. By choosing carefully, I can help keep my outdoor air conditioner in better shape for years to come.
